Nice play on words Critic. I guess no one noticed my use of bold in the first post. Anyway, somebody dropped the ball on the confidentiality part and the name is clearly visible in one of the docs as well as a few hard to see photos. Moto's secret new phone, which isn't so secret anymore, is called the V3. I'm suprised nobody has picked up on this yet, or found the documents too boring to get to the good stuff. It is for GSM. It is similar in functionality to a V710. So why the big secret? Well right on the page requesting confidentiality they spell it out. "This equipment is significantly “thinner” than other marketed Cellular/PCS transceivers. Due to the technology involved in the unique form factor of this product, Motorola additionally requests 45 day confidentiality on exhibits containing equipment photographs or illustrations." So it is very thin and very different looking. By Tuesday we will know more. |

I wonder if this phone uses the Mitsubishi double sided (reversible) LCD screen in order to make it so much thinner than other cell phones. I remember reading about this a few months back. Here is an article on that technology. http://www.computerworld.com/hardwar...,90276,00.html In that Computeworld article, it says "The display, which the company says is a first, was developed initially for use in clamshell-type cellular telephone handsets and could help make such telephones thinner and lighter. Many clamshell-style handsets have two displays, a large main display that faces inward and a smaller subdisplay that faces outward and is used to show basic information when the phone is closed and the main display is out of view.
